Herunterladen Inhalt Inhalt Diese Seite drucken

Funktionsweise Der Zeiten - Siemens SIMATIC S7 Serie Systemhandbuch

Inhaltsverzeichnis

Werbung

Signalwechsel in der gewünschten Richtung hinweisen, wird eine Flanke gemeldet, indem der
Ausgang auf WAHR gesetzt wird. Andernfalls wird der Ausgang auf FALSCH gesetzt.
Hinweis
Flankenoperationen werten den Eingang und die Merkerwerte bei jeder Ausführung aus, auch
bei der ersten Ausführung. Sie müssen die Ausgangszustände des Eingangs und des Merkers in
Ihrem Programm berücksichtigen, um die Flankenerkennung im ersten Zyklus zuzulassen oder
nicht.
Weil der Merker von einer Ausführung zur nächsten gespeichert werden muss, müssen Sie für
jede Flankenoperation ein eindeutiges Bit verwenden. Dieses Bit dürfen Sie nicht an anderen
Stellen in Ihrem Programm nutzen. Vermeiden Sie außerdem temporären Speicher und
Speicher, der von anderen Systemfunktionen geändert werden kann, z. B. E/A-Aktualisierungen.
Verwenden Sie nur Merker (M), globale DBs oder statischen Speicher (in einem Instanz-DB) für
M_BIT-Speicherzuweisungen.
8.2

Funktionsweise der Zeiten

Mit den Zeitanweisungen können Sie programmierte Zeitverzögerungen einrichten. Die Anzahl
der Zeiten, die Sie in Ihrem Anwenderprogramm verwenden können, ist lediglich durch den
Speicherplatz in der CPU begrenzt. Jede Zeit nutzt eine 16 Byte große DB-Struktur vom Datentyp
IEC_Timer, um Zeitdaten zu speichern, die im oberen Bereich der Box- oder Spulenanweisung
angegeben werden. STEP 7 erstellt automatisch den DB, wenn Sie die Anweisung einfügen.
Tabelle 8-18 Zeitoperationen
KOP/FUP-Boxen
KOP-Spu‐
len
S7-1200 Automatisierungssystem
Systemhandbuch, V4.5 05/2021, A5E02486681-AO
SCL
"IEC_Timer_0_DB".TP(
IN:=_bool_in_,
PT:=_time_in_,
Q=>_bool_out_,
ET=>_time_out_);
"IEC_Timer_0_DB".TON (
IN:=_bool_in_,
PT:=_time_in_,
Q=>_bool_out_,
ET=>_time_out_);
"IEC_Timer_0_DB".TOF (
IN:=_bool_in_,
PT:=_time_in_,
Q=>_bool_out_,
ET=>_time_out_);
8.2 Funktionsweise der Zeiten
Beschreibung
Die Zeit TP erzeugt einen Impuls mit einer voreinge‐
stellten Dauer.
Die Zeit TON setzt den Ausgang Q nach einer vor‐
eingestellten Zeit auf EIN.
Die Zeit TOF setzt den Ausgang Q nach einer vorein‐
gestellten Zeit auf AUS zurück.
Anweisungen
217

Quicklinks ausblenden:

Werbung

Inhaltsverzeichnis
loading

Diese Anleitung auch für:

Simatic s7-1200

Inhaltsverzeichnis